Women's Soccer Faces Two Of The Top-Four Teams In The GLVC This Week

10/17/2019 8:30:00 AM

The University of Illinois Springfield women's soccer team starts a challenging four-game road trip this week. The Prairie Stars will be facing three of the top-four teams in the GLVC over the next four games, including two this week in Southern Indiana on Friday night, and McKendree on Sunday afternoon.
 
UIS (6-6-0, 5-4-0)
UIS went 1-1-0 last week, falling to Bellarmine by a 2-0 score before a double overtime win over Indianapolis by a 2-1 margin. The win over the Greyhounds was the program's fifth GLVC victory of the year, one shy of the program record.
 
In GLVC-only games, UIS is currently 13th in offense with 0.78 goals a game. The Prairie Stars are 11th with a 1.09 GAA. The team is 5-0 when scoring one or more goals, and 5-0 when allowing just one or fewer scores.
 
Maggie Juhlin is second in GLVC contests with four goals, one behind the leader. She also ranks in the top-10 in points, and leads the league with four game-winning goals. Lauren Griffin is second in the league with three assists in GLVC games.
 
About Southern Indiana (8-3-0, 6-3-0)
Southern Indiana saw its season-best five-game winning streak snapped last time out, as it fell to Rockhurst by a 2-0 score. Prior to that game, it had shutout five straight opponents.
 
The Screaming Eagles rank fourth in the GLVC in both offensive and defensive statistics. They are scoring 1.33 goals per conference game, and have a 0.67 GAA in that span.
 
On the season, Maggie Winter and Katlyn Andres are the team's scoring leaders with four goals apiece. Madelyne Juenger has a team-high four assists. Maya Etienne is the team's top goalie with a .895 save percentage and a 0.56 GAA.
 
UIS vs. Southern Indiana Series History
UIS is 0-8-2 all-time against Southern Indiana, including a 0-5-0 mark in Evansville, Ind. Last year on the road, the Prairie Stars lost to the Screaming Eagles by a 1-0 margin.
 
About McKendree (9-2-1, 7-1-1)
McKendree saw an eight-game unbeaten streak snapped last week with a 1-0 setback against Rockhurst. The team bounced back though with a 1-0 win over William Jewell.
 
The Bearcats have the top defense in the GLVC, allowing just three goals in nine conference games. Offensively, they are tied for fifth with 1.22 goals a game.
 
The defense is led by Zoe Brochu, who has a conference-best .929 save percentage in league games. She is second with a 0.33 GAA. Offensively, Sydnee Carroll leads the team on the season with three goals and seven points.
 
UIS vs. McKendree Series History
UIS is 1-8-0 all-time against McKendree, including a 0-4-0 mark in Lebanon, Ill. McKendree has won four straight games in the series, with the last three, including the 2018 meeting, all being decided by a 1-0 margin.

GLVC Standings
UIS enters play this week in a three-way tie for seventh-place in the GLVC standings. Southern Indiana is currently fourth, and McKendree is in second, ½ game behind league leader Rockhurst.
